Chunk #7 — 2. Reactive microglia induce A1 reactive astrocytes by secreting Il-1α, TNFα and C1q

To ensure no other factors secreted by LPS-activated microglia could also make A1s, we collected LPS-activated MCM and pre-treated it with neutralizing antibodies to Il-1α, TNFα, and C1q. This pre-treated MCM was unable to induce reactive astrocyte genes (Fig. 1a, Extended Data Fig. 3e). Thus Il-1α, TNFα and C1q together are sufficient to induce the A1 phenotype, and are necessary for LPS-reactive microglia to induce A1s in vitro.
